Texas Instruments reports big profit drop
Chip giant unveils plan to cut 3,400 jobs, 12% of its work force

SAN FRANCISCO (MarketWatch) -- Texas Instruments Inc. on Monday reported a huge drop in quarterly profit and unveiled a plan to eliminate 3,400 jobs as the chip giant warned it expects a "prolonged economic weakness."
Chart of TXN
TI reported a fourth-quarter net income of $107 million, or 8 cents a share, compared with a net income of $756 million, or 54 cents a share, for the year-earlier period.
Revenue was $2.49 billion, down from $3.56 billion last year. The results included restructuring charges of 13 cents a share.
Analysts had expected the Dallas-based chip maker to report earnings of 12 cents a share, on revenue of $2.37 billion, according to a consensus survey by Thomson Reuters.
The chip maker also announced a plan to cut 3,400 jobs, or 12% of its work force. TI said it will reduce 1,800 positions through layoffs, and 1,600 through voluntary retirement and departures.
